Letter to the editor | Support greatly appreciated

Published: July 11, 2012 

As our community stands down from two recent high-visibility trials, I commend the support we received from various sources.

In particular, I sincerely appreciate Sheriff Mark Lusk, of Lycoming County, and Lycoming County’s Board of Commissioners, which endorsed Lusk’s unilateral offer of support during that challenging period.

In my 21-year tenure as sheriff of Centre County, I have never encountered a situation in which the county’s law enforcement resources were taxed as heavily as what we experienced last month. It was clear from the beginning that competing demands on limited manpower resources would challenge our goal of providing truly safe professional security at both venues.

Lusk’s offer of support provided the necessary boost in manpower required to ensure that both dynamic venues were covered, while simultaneously managing other standing responsibilities within the Sheriff’s Office.

It is times like this that I see our commonwealth truly pulling together. While the situation had the potential to become quite fluid, chaos was held in check.

My appreciation extends to all who supported this challenging period, but I especially commend Lusk and the Lycoming commissioners for their contribution to the cause.

Denny Nau Centre County sheriff
